Dear Friends, It is with great sadness that we announce the cancellation of the 21st Annual Elmwood Avenue Festival of the Arts due to the Covid-19 pandemic. The festival is a large public event that has always been free and open to all. Our Committee has come to the conclusion that we cannot honestly create a safe environment for our all volunteer staff, 250 volunteers, 170 artists, 55 cultural groups, food vendors and tens of thousands of attendees. We also believe we wo...uld not be granted all of the permits from the state, county and city needed to legally operate. We plan on creating ongoing artist, craftspeople and musician promotions as well as concerts. Links will be on our website (https://elmwoodartfest.org) and our Facebook page. If able, please support all of our artists and the Elmwood businesses. Almost all festivals have been canceled for the summer. Many artists and musicians are facing significant losses of income. We are so grateful for all the love and support the festival has received over the past two decades. The dates for 2021 are August 28-29. We look forward to another twenty years of bringing our community together to celebrate the creative spirit we all share. Sincerely, Joe DiPasquale for The Festival Committee

The Festival is seeking artists, craftspeople, musicians, dancers, puppeteers, food vendors, non profit organizations and volunteers. The Festival was the first festival in WNY to recycle, compost, have solar powered stages and focus on local creativity. Come join us!
